Composition, Origin, and the Role of Biotin (Vitamin B7)

The principal active ingredient in Tricovit is Biotin, identified as Vitamin B7 or Vitamin H. Biotin belongs to the water-soluble B vitamin group. Tricovit is a combination product, pairing Biotin with other crucial elements, including the amino acids L-Cysteine and L-Methionine, and vital minerals like Iron and Zinc. Although Biotin is a naturally occurring compound, the final product is a purified, synthetic formulation, ensuring standardized dosing. The blend of L-Cysteine and Biotin is described as synergistic for improving keratin infrastructure.

Critical Safety Constraint: Laboratory Test Interference

The most significant safety consideration documented by global agencies, including the FDA and EMA, is the potential for interference with clinical laboratory tests. When taken at high levels, Biotin can cause falsely high or falsely low results in immunoassays that utilize biotin-streptavidin technology. This may affect the accuracy of results for critical biomarkers, such as cardiac troponin and thyroid hormones, posing a risk of misdiagnosis or inappropriate patient management.

Serious Reactions and Population Safety

Serious adverse reactions officially noted in this category include severe Anaphylactic reactions (a type of acute allergic response). Furthermore, regulatory bodies have documented severe outcomes, including a fatal adverse event, linked to delayed diagnosis due to Biotin interference affecting critical cardiac tests. The risk for this laboratory test interference is noted to be potentially higher in populations such as children and patients with renal impairment. All individuals undergoing medical laboratory testing must inform personnel about Biotin consumption, as specified by regulatory safety communications.

Overdose and Emergency Response

Overdose and When to Seek Help

Official regulatory documentation classifies the active ingredient in Tricovit, Biotin (Vitamin B7), as having low inherent toxicity. As a water-soluble vitamin, Biotin is generally well-tolerated even at high intake levels, and no specific clinical toxic syndrome or defined symptom cluster is routinely described in official labeling or government summaries for acute overdose.

Element Official Regulatory Statement
Documented Manifestations No specific clinical toxicity profile has been established for acute over-ingestion of Biotin.
Emergency Action Required Seek immediate medical attention or contact emergency services for suspected massive over-ingestion or the occurrence of any severe, unusual physical reaction.

Management and Monitoring Considerations

Management of over-ingestion is strictly limited to symptomatic and supportive treatment, a necessity because no specific antidote is known for Biotin. Regulatory authorities note that the primary documented risk related to very high exposure is the potential for interference with specific laboratory immunoassays. This includes tests like cardiac troponin and certain thyroid function panels, necessitating that this factor be specifically taken into account during clinical assessment and monitoring following accidental high intake. Population-specific overdose risks are not cited in the official documents.

What should I know about interactions with other medicines?

Interactions with other medicines and products

The interaction profile of Tricovit, whose main component is Biotin (Vitamin B7), is defined primarily by its capacity to interfere with diagnostic testing and its documented interactions with specific medicinal products.

Interference with Diagnostic Testing

High-dose Biotin can cause clinically significant false results in certain laboratory immunoassays that use Biotin-Streptavidin technology. This interference can lead to falsely high or falsely low values for critical analytes, including troponin and various hormone assays (e.g., thyroid hormones). The risk of this interference is noted to be higher in patients with renal impairment, children, and neonates. To mitigate this procedural constraint, patients using high-dose Biotin are advised to abstain from use for at least 48 to 72 hours prior to specimen collection for these tests.

Exposure-Modifying Substances

Co-administration with certain medicinal products can affect Biotin levels. Prolonged use of anticonvulsant medications (such as phenytoin, carbamazepine, phenobarbital, and primidone) is documented to significantly lower Biotin blood levels. Furthermore, specific antimicrobial agents may decrease the level or effect of Biotin by altering intestinal flora. For example, a timing-based rule requires the administration of Ciprofloxacin to be separated by several hours from Biotin intake. The prolonged consumption of raw egg whites is also a documented food interaction that impairs Biotin absorption.

Dosage and Administration Information

How Tricovit is Used: Administration Guidelines

This section describes the usage patterns for Biotin-containing supplements, such as Tricovit.


Administration Scope

The medicine is designed for oral administration as a solid unit, typically a tablet or capsule, and is taken whole. The usage pattern involves a high-level supplemental dose of Biotin, ranging from 2.5 mg (2,500 mcg) up to 10 mg (10,000 mcg), which is significantly higher than the 30 mcg Adequate Intake (AI). The dosing frequency for the oral unit is consistently once daily.


Procedural and Time-Related Use

Usage of this supplement is generally incorporated into a long-term plan, as the required time to observe changes in structural tissues, such as hair and nails, often extends to six months or more. No specific administration instructions regarding timing with meals are universally mandated.

For specific populations, the nutritional intake for pregnant or breastfeeding adults is 30 mcg to 35 mcg per day.


Special Administration Constraint

High doses of Biotin (ge 150 micrograms or 0.15 mg) must be disclosed to laboratory personnel before certain blood tests. This administrative disclosure is a procedural step required because Biotin can interfere with the results of specific clinical laboratory assays, including those for thyroid and cardiac function.

Recent Clinical Evidence

Research Evidence for Compromised Hair Vitality

Research has explored the supplement components in the context of conditions characterized by hair thinning or a general lack of vitality. Studies primarily utilized Randomized Controlled Trials (RCTs) and systematic reviews, focusing on adults with conditions such as Chronic Telogen Effluvium (CTE) and Androgenetic Alopecia (AGA), as well as those with documented nutritional imbalances or Biotin deficiency. Researchers monitored objective measurements like hair density and the Anagen/Telogen ratio. Findings were heterogeneous; while some trials described data points observed in objective measurements, other studies did not report statistically significant differences when the supplement was compared to placebo in non-deficient populations. Evidence is limited and heterogeneous, reflecting the specific conditions under which trials were conducted.


Research Evidence for Brittle Nail Syndrome

Research has explored the supplement's components in studies involving individuals with symptoms including nail fragility, splitting, and reduced firmness. The evidence base relies heavily on case reports and observational studies, with fewer large-scale clinical trials. In these studies, data were collected to monitor nail growth rate and firmness. Reported findings often describe measurements that were recorded in individuals with diagnosed Brittle Nail Syndrome or Biotin deficiency. Evidence remains largely observational, and most reported outcomes reflect the use of Biotin as a single ingredient rather than the full combination formula, contributing to lower certainty.


Research Gaps and Limitations

The long-term effects are not fully established, as most trials utilized follow-up durations that were limited, typically 3 to 6 months. Research has not adequately examined the durability of reported measurements after the observation interval concluded. Additionally, data for certain groups, such as children, older adults, or pregnant populations, remain insufficient. The current evidence base has limitations, including modest sample sizes and heterogeneity across studies, meaning comparative evidence is lacking to isolate the role of the full combination product.

How should Tricovit be stored and disposed of?

Tricovit, typically an oral tablet or capsule, must be stored under specific conditions to maintain its quality and potency. Official labeling mandates storage in a cool, dry place and protection from light and heat sources. The product must be kept in its original container and the container should remain tightly closed to prevent moisture and air ingress. A critical requirement is to keep the product out of the sight and reach of children at all times. The expiration date is only valid if the product has been stored correctly.

For disposal, unused or expired Tricovit must be discarded according to local regulations. Consumers should not dispose of the tablets in the toilet or sink (wastewater), as this is not permitted for this type of non-hazardous supplement. The FDA recommends using drug take-back programs or mixing the product with an unappealing substance before placing it in the household trash.
